1

Computer Numerically Controlled Tool Programmers Jobs

Tool & Die Maker II

Clinton, TN ยท On-site

$24 - $30/hr

Through our robust product engineering, outstanding tooling capabilities and diverse process ... without assistance (excludes Computer Numerically Controlled [CNC] equipment) * Work to ...

CNC PROGRAMMER/MACHINIST

Rock Hill, SC ยท On-site

$22 - $30/hr

Program computer numerically controlled (CNC) milling machine, lathe and router using MasterCam ... Candidate is the owner of a Certificate of Qualification for a General Machinist or Tool and Die ...

Collaborate with Tool Designer to help develop and design new tools and dies. * Setup and operate conventional or computer numerically controlled machine tools such as lathes, milling machines, drill ...

Toolmaker

Warwick, RI ยท On-site

Collaborate with Tool Designer to help develop and design new tools and dies. * Setup and operate conventional or computer numerically controlled machine tools such as lathes, milling machines, drill ...

Collaborate with Tool Designer to help develop and design new tools and dies. * Setup and operate conventional or computer numerically controlled machine tools such as lathes, milling machines, drill ...

Tool Crib Attendant

Ogden, UT ยท On-site

$17.50 - $21.25/hr

The Tool Crib Attendant is responsible for the controlled management, traceability, and continuous ... Serving as a key support function to Production, Engineering, Quality, and Supply Chain, the Tool ...

Tool and Die Maker

Saginaw, MI

$24.25 - $30.50/hr

WHAT YOU'LL ACCOMPLISH Interpret engineering blueprints to craft, assemble, and repair specialized ... Set up and operate manual and Computer Numerically Controlled (CNC) machines, including lathes ...

CNC Machinist I

Lexington, SC ยท On-site

$17.50 - $24/hr

They will perform the set-up and operation of Computer Numerically Controlled (CNC) equipment, as ... tool building, and tool setting. * Correct incorrect programming on CNC machines. * Train up to ...

Tool Crib Attendant

Ogden, UT

$17.50 - $21.25/hr

The Tool Crib Attendant is responsible for the controlled management, traceability, and continuous ... Serving as a key support function to Production, Engineering, Quality, and Supply Chain, the Tool ...

CNC Machinist I

Lexington, SC

$17.50 - $24/hr

They will perform the set-up and operation of Computer Numerically Controlled (CNC) equipment, as ... tool building, and tool setting. * Correct incorrect programming on CNC machines. * Train up to ...

CNC Lathe Machinist

Corona, CA ยท On-site

$25 - $30/hr

Operate computer numerically controlled (CNC) lathes, mills, and other equipment. Includes but not ... tool tips, and setting zero positions. * Complete routine visual and dimensional in-process ...

CNC Operator

Portland, OR

$21.75 - $29.75/hr

Programming and operation of computer numerically controlled (CNC) machinery to produce high ... Perform tool maintenance, including tool sharpening * Perform CNC machine repair and replacement of ...

CNC Operator

Portland, OR

$21.75 - $29.75/hr

Programming and operation of computer numerically controlled (CNC) machinery to produce high ... Perform tool maintenance, including tool sharpening * Perform CNC machine repair and replacement of ...

CNC Lathe Machinist

Corona, CA ยท On-site

$25 - $30/hr

Operate computer numerically controlled (CNC) lathes, mills, and other equipment. Includes but not ... tool tips, and setting zero positions. * Complete routine visual and dimensional in-process ...

next page

Showing results 1-20

Computer Numerically Controlled Tool Programmers information

See salary details

$33K

$65K

$95.5K

How much do computer numerically controlled tool programmers jobs pay per year?

As of Jun 23, 2026, the average yearly pay for computer numerically controlled tool programmers in the United States is $64,974.00, according to ZipRecruiter salary data. Most workers in this role earn between $50,500.00 and $80,000.00 per year, depending on experience, location, and employer.

Is a CNC job a good career?

A CNC (Computer Numerically Controlled) tool programmer is a skilled trade that offers steady employment opportunities in manufacturing and machining industries. It typically requires technical training, familiarity with CAD/CAM software, and attention to detail, with job prospects often improving as automation increases. Overall, it can be a stable and well-paying career for those interested in precision manufacturing and technology.

What is the difference between Computer Numerically Controlled Tool Programmers vs CNC Machinists?

AspectComputer Numerically Controlled Tool ProgrammersCNC Machinists
CredentialsTypically require technical training or certifications in CNC programmingOften need technical skills, certifications, or vocational training in machining
Work EnvironmentPrimarily work in programming and setup of CNC machines, often in manufacturing settingsOperate CNC machines directly, perform machining tasks on the shop floor
Employer & Industry UsageUsed by manufacturing companies to develop and optimize CNC programsUsed by manufacturing companies to produce parts by operating CNC equipment

Computer Numerically Controlled Tool Programmers focus on creating and optimizing CNC programs, while CNC Machinists operate the machines to produce parts. Both roles are essential in manufacturing, but programmers are more involved in the planning and setup, whereas machinists handle the hands-on operation.

What is a CNC programmer's salary?

A CNC programmer's salary typically ranges from $50,000 to $80,000 annually, depending on experience, location, and industry. Skilled programmers with certifications and proficiency in CAD/CAM software may earn higher wages and additional benefits.

Is there a demand for CNC programmers?

There is strong demand for CNC programmers as manufacturing industries continue to expand and adopt advanced machining technologies. Skilled programmers who can operate CAD/CAM software and set up CNC machines are especially sought after in aerospace, automotive, and metalworking sectors. Job opportunities are expected to grow with ongoing automation and technological advancements in manufacturing.

Do CNC programmers make good money?

CNC programmers typically earn competitive wages that vary by experience, location, and industry. Skilled programmers with certifications and proficiency in CAD/CAM software often have higher earning potential, and the job may include benefits such as overtime and shift differentials.
What cities are hiring for Computer Numerically Controlled Tool Programmers jobs? Cities with the most Computer Numerically Controlled Tool Programmers job openings:
What states have the most Computer Numerically Controlled Tool Programmers jobs? States with the most job openings for Computer Numerically Controlled Tool Programmers jobs include:
Tool & Die Maker II

Tool & Die Maker II

Magna

Clinton, TN โ€ข On-site

$24 - $30/hr

Full-time

Medical, Dental, Vision, Retirement, PTO

Posted 27 days ago


Job description

Job descriptions may display in multiple languagesbased on your language selection.

What we offer:
At Magna, you can expect an engaging and dynamic environment where you can help to develop industry-leading automotive technologies. We invest in our employees, providing them with the support and resources they need to succeed. As a member of our global team, you can expect exciting, varied responsibilities as well as a wide range of development prospects. Because we believe that your career path should be as unique as you are.
Group Summary:
Cosma provides a comprehensive range of body, chassis and engineering solutions to global customers. Through our robust product engineering, outstanding tooling capabilities and diverse process expertise, we continue to bring lightweight and innovative products to market.

Job Responsibilities:

To build, troubleshoot, repair, and maintain basic and complex dies, fixtures, and all other tooling related to the manufacture and assembly of stamped, roll formed, and welded steel automobile components which meet or exceed customer requirements

Responsibilities:

Responsible for quality and conformance of product to customer specifications per control plans utilizing TS16949 & ISO14001 documented systems; authority to stop non-conforming processes and report same to supervisor, Quality Assurance and/or Engineering department representative

  • Work to blueprints, sketches, and verbal instructions to repair and maintain both basic and complex stamping and hot stamping dies and assembly tooling

  • Support production department with tooling needs

  • Respond to shop-floor service calls in a timely manner

  • Assure safe operation and care of tool room equipment

  • Produce quality work in a timely manner

  • Assess complex tooling and equipment needs and refurbish as required

  • Troubleshoot and solve tooling problems without assistance

  • Set-up and operate all manual tool room equipment without assistance (excludes Computer Numerically Controlled [CNC] equipment)

  • Work to continuously improve tooling and reduce scrap

  • Ability to lead continuous improvement and emergency repair projects individually or within a team

  • Assist with training apprentice tool & die makers on skills required by the trade

  • Housekeeping and other activities as assigned

Qualifications:

  • Tool & Die Maker experience

  • 6 years (including apprenticeship) preferred

  • Crane certification preferred

Skills:

  • Ability to read tool and die designs and prints

  • Basic shop math and trigonometry

  • Ability to use precise measuring equipment

  • Ability to operate all standard tool room equipment

  • Must be able to work without supervision and lead small teams as required on large and complex projects

  • Ability to train and develop apprentices

  • Individual must be self-motivated

  • Ability to read, write, and speak English

  • Ability to communicate well with others

  • Ability to work overtime

  • Individual must observe all safety regulations to ensure own and others' safety

Education:

  • High school diploma or equivalent

  • Completion of Tool and Die Maker apprenticeship preferred

  • Evidence of learned skills acquired through experience in the trade, as determined by the supervisor, in lieu of formal apprenticeship

Benefits

  • Low-Cost Health Insurance

  • Low-Cost Dental Insurance + Vision Insurance

  • 401(k) Matching

  • Employee Profit Sharing Plan

  • Paid Vacation

  • Paid Holidays

  • Parental Leave

  • Nursing Room

  • Tuition Reimbursement and Online Career Development with Free Tuition

  • Referral Program - Up to $1,500 per Skill Trade Referral

  • Onsite cafeteria Serving Hot Breakfast and Lunch

  • Self-Checkout Snacks and Drinks Market

  • Employee Assistance Program

  • Employee Discount Program

  • Annual Employee and Family Events

Awareness, Unity, Empowerment:

At Magna, we believe that a diverse workforce is critical to our success. That's why we are proud to be an equal opportunity employer. We hire on the basis of experience and qualifications, and in consideration of job requirements, regardless of, in particular, color, ancestry, religion, gender, origin, sexual orientation, age, citizenship, marital status, disability or gender identity. Magna takes the privacy of your personal information seriously. We discourage you from sending applications via email or traditional mail to comply with GDPR requirements and your local Data Privacy Law.

AI-Assisted Screening Disclosure

As part of our commitment to a fair, consistent, and efficient recruitment process, we may use artificial intelligence (AI) tools to assist in the initial screening of applications submitted through our Workday system. These tools help identify qualifications and experience that align with the role requirements. Please note that AI is used solely to support our recruiters. Final decisions are always made by the hiring manager and the hiring team. Importantly, no applicant data is shared externally through these AI tools. All information remains securely within our systems and is handled in accordance with our privacy and data protection policies.

Under conditions defined by applicable law, you may have the right to request an explanation of how AI is used to support decision-making.

If you have any questions or concerns about this process, feel free to contact our Talent Attraction team.

Worker Type:

Regular / Permanent

Group:

Cosma International